Vegetation diversity in the area


               From  the  surveyed  area,  a  total  of  48  floral  species  and  carnivorous  plant  species  like

               Utricularia  aurea  were  documented.  Of  the  species  of  plants,  habit  diversity  was  also
               observed, in that 33 species were herbs, 1 climbers, 1 ferns, 6 shrubs, and  7 trees (Table1).

               Among  the  aquatic  vegetation  in  the  project  area  the  most  striking  ones,  were  mangrove
               specie  such  as  Avicennia  sp.,  mangrove  associates  like  Clerodendron  sp,  Clerodendrum

               paniculatum,  Pandanus  sp,  Wedelia  trilobata  etc,  hydrophytes  like  Salvinia  molesta,
               weedyspp  Acalypha  indica,  Mimosa  pudica  etc  and  cultivated  species  Anacardium

               occidentale, Cocos nucifera, Ficus hispida, Mangifera indica.  Only 14% of the total number

               of species recorded from the area, were tree species. The common tree species recorded were
               Anacardium,                    occidentale,                 Mangifera                   sp.

               Herbs were dominant in the area with 68.15% of the documented population.
